OpenStack Announces First Superuser Awards Recognizing Team Accomplishments In 2014

04:02:48 - 28 August 2014

Call for Submissions Closes September 19th, Winners to Be Announced at Upcoming Paris Summit

AUSTIN, Texas--(BUSINESS WIRE)--OpenStack, the open source software for building clouds, today announced the Superuser Awards, recognizing one outstanding team using OpenStack to improve their business while contributing meaningfully to the OpenStack community. Any company or individual may nominate a team for consideration, including their own. The call for submissions is now open.

The Superuser Awards follow the launch of the Superuser, a publication targeted at OpenStack users with the purpose of facilitating knowledge sharing and collaborative problem solving among individuals and organizations running OpenStack clouds of all sizes and across all industries. The OpenStack Foundation introduced the concept of Superusers at the OpenStack Summit in May to celebrate the individuals who are change agents who are transforming the way they do business from the ground up. The Superuser Awards are the next step that the OpenStack Foundation is taking to support and celebrate the work of OpenStack end-users and operators.

“We make a point of talking to OpenStack users every week, and we are continually impressed with teams who have driven real change and business value in their organizations using OpenStack. We’d like to recognize these individuals, and share their experiences to inspire and share best practices among our community and the broader industry,” said Jonathan Bryce, executive director of the OpenStack Foundation.

Finalists will be determined by the unique nature of use case(s), as well as integrations and applications of OpenStack within a given team. Additional selection criteria includes:

  • Demonstration of organizational transformation
  • Illustration of new product, time to market or money saved with deployment
  • Growth of deployment, in terms of size and number of users
  • Community impact in terms of contributions, feedback, knowledge sharing, etc.

The call for award submissions will close at 11:59 p.m. CT on September 19th, 2014. Judging will begin immediately, and finalists will be asked to participate in a supplementary interview with an OpenStack representative within one week. Winners will be formally recognized onstage at the OpenStack Paris Summit, taking place from November 3 - 7, 2014.

About OpenStack

OpenStack is open source software for building clouds. OpenStack clouds enable businesses to rapidly roll out new products, add new features, and improve internal systems while preventing technology lock-in as the only open source cloud platform that’s supported by every IT industry leader. Hundreds of the world’s largest brands rely on OpenStack to run their businesses every day, reducing costs and accelerating time to market.

OpenStack is backed by an independent Foundation and global community with more than 15,900 individual members and 347 supporting organizations across 137 countries. For more information and to join the community, visit http://www.OpenStack.org.
